Start with a new battery, or having yours load tested.
A bad comp will not make your starter/engine turn over slow.
A bad starter clutch will make a grinding sound and sometimes not engage.
A bad starter motor can and may turn over slow after getting hot - when going bad.
That said, it's probably the battery.
